Synopsis
Presents a graphic novel adaptation of the famous novel, in which a unicorn, alone in an enchanted wood, discovers she might be the last of her kind and sets out on a journey to find others like her. A magician and a very old but beautiful unicorn travel the world in search of others of her species.
Is The last unicorn appropriate for my child?
Suitable for most readers 10 and up.
A gentle quest fantasy about a unicorn's search for her lost kind, featuring mild peril and themes of loneliness and extinction. No violence, romance, or mature content.
What to know going in
This book has mild violence, no sexual content, and clean language. Content notes include loneliness and extinction.
